Output dfc2576d40782143174bf66beb92c3a7b6c23e32c42a55ee577bb966c0525409:2

value
3437480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b83089fe71784fd7b5ec23169d9543f8c335d48 OP_EQUAL
address
35f5xAyiQ7qFbbkC5XVww4jeCoPzC4oun8
transaction
dfc2576d40782143174bf66beb92c3a7b6c23e32c42a55ee577bb966c0525409
confirmations
342643
spent
true